AJ Styles Announces WWE Retirement, Fears of Embarrassment Loom

Professional wrestler AJ Styles, aged 48, has announced his impending retirement from in-ring competition by 2026. This statement came just before his highly anticipated match against John Cena at WWE Crown Jewel, scheduled for Saturday in Perth, Australia. Styles discussed his decision during the Crown Jewel Kickoff Show, emphasizing his desire to prioritize family and concerns about further embarrassment in the ring.

AJ Styles Looks Toward Retirement

Styles revealed that the thought of embarrassing himself is a significant factor in his decision to step back from wrestling. He stated, “I am getting older. The fear of embarrassing myself is getting closer.” This reflection on aging underscores the physical and emotional aspects faced by athletes nearing the end of their careers.

Significance of Upcoming Match

This weekend’s match against John Cena is particularly poignant, as it aligns with Cena’s own retirement tour, which is set to conclude in 2025. After Crown Jewel, Cena has only four more scheduled appearances in his wrestling career, making this bout immensely significant for both competitors.

Rivalry and Legacy

Styles and Cena’s rivalry dates back to 2016 and 2017, during which they delivered some of the most memorable matches in WWE history. As Styles gears up to face Cena, he confidently remarked that he aims to “beat up John Cena” at the Crown Jewel event.

Career Highlights

  • First big break in WCW in 2001 as “Air Styles.”
  • Competed in Ring of Honor from 2002 to 2006.
  • Achieved success in TNA, where he secured five world titles and multiple championships.
  • Moved to New Japan Pro-Wrestling and held the IWGP Heavyweight Championship twice.
  • Debuted in WWE in 2016 with a surprise entrance in the Royal Rumble.
  • Accomplished a Hall-of-Fame-worthy career, becoming a two-time WWE Champion.
  • Also a three-time United States Champion and a one-time Intercontinental Champion.
